The upholstery fabric is also gaining popularity.
Coordinating textiles throughout the home is one of the top decorating trends for 2026. When selecting print drapes for accent chairs, benches and dining chairs, designers are using block prints with matching upholstery fabric. This allows for visual continuity without overwhelming an interior.
Patterns on windows can be a subtle link between the furnishings and the living room, making it look more intentional. It’s a popular method that instantly takes a space to a whole new level with designer approval.
Expert Tip
Pick a large-scale print (drapes) and a smaller, matching one (upholstery fabric). This will help give balance and create visual interest.
Cotton Fabric Maintains Spaces Comfortably
Comfort is a growing trend in homes for American homeowners. Hence, cotton fabric is still one of the most sought-after fabrics for home decor.
Printed cotton drapes are block printed to offer:
• Natural breathability
• Soft texture
• Easy everyday elegance
• Year-round comfort
For people who enjoy intricate hand-printing, there is no better fabric than cotton to showcase such designs in natural light, as it makes the designs look crisp and detailed.
